8 Highlight events at the Northwest Quintessence Festival – Dien Bien 2025
The Northwest Quintessence Festival 2025, a large-scale regional cultural and tourism event will take place in Dien Bien from September 19th - 21st, 2025, featuring a wide variety of rich and unique activities that promise to bring people and visitors many extraordinary experiences.

As one of the highlights of 2025, the Northwest Quintessence Festival – Dien Bien aims to further promote and strengthen tourism cooperation and development between the expanded Northwest provinces and Ho Chi Minh City. It contributes to effectively exploiting tourism potential and advantages of localities, gradually forming unique economic, cultural, and tourism products at regional and international levels. The festival will be organized on a grand scale with 8 highlight events:
1. Grand Opening Ceremony
To be held at the Provincial Stadium at 20:10 on September 19th, 2025, and broadcast live on Provincial Radio and Television as well as rebroadcast by participating provinces and cities. The opening art program will be elaborately staged, blending tradition and modernity, with nearly 600 professional and amateur artists and performers. It will recreate the beauty of nature, heroic history, and the rich cultural identity of the Northwest. A highlight will be a fireworks display marking the beginning of the Festival.
2. Conference on Promotion, Advertising, and Development of Northwest – Ho Chi Minh City Tourism
To be held at the Dien Bien Phu Cultural Exchange and Tourism Information Center at 08:00 on September 20th, 2025. This will be a platform to promote and introduce new tourism products and services, while exchanging solutions to strengthen linkages and cooperation in tourism development between the expanded Northwest provinces and Ho Chi Minh City.
3. Street Festival “Northwest Quintessence”
Scheduled at 20:10 on September 20th, 2025, along Vo Nguyen Giap Street (from 7-5 Square to the Ceremony Ground of the Dien Bien Phu Victory Monument). The event promises a vibrant artistic space with parades, folk singing, folk dances, folk music, traditional costumes, and traditional crafts such as embroidery and brocade weaving. Nearly 900 officials, artisans, performers, students, and members of associations, clubs, and local communities will participate, creating a lively cultural exchange between visitors and local people.
4. Exhibition and Promotion of Unique Tourist Destinations of the Expanded Northwest Provinces and Ho Chi Minh City
To be held at 7-5 Square from September 19th - 21st, 2025. The exhibition will showcase outstanding tourist destinations, events, and tourism stimulus programs of the expanded Northwest provinces and Ho Chi Minh City, with additional participation from Northern Laos.
5. Northwest Culinary Festival
To be held at 7-5 Square from September 19th - 21st, 2025, featuring 14 provinces and cities along with local restaurants, units, and food businesses. The festival will present numerous signature dishes from different regions to visitors.
6. Photo Exhibition “Colors of the Northwest”
To be held at 7-5 Square from September 19th - 21st, 2025. The exhibition will showcase beautiful photos highlighting tourism potential, destinations, and traditional cultural identities of the expanded Northwest provinces and Ho Chi Minh City.
7. Experiential Tourism Program
Starting at 14:00 on September 20th, 2025, visitors will tour historical sites such as Hill A1, De Castries’ Bunker, Dien Bien Phu Victory Monument, and the Dien Bien Phu Victory Museum.
8. Art Exchange Program
At 20:00 on September 21st, 2025, at 7-5 Square, performing groups from the expanded Northwest provinces and Ho Chi Minh City will present folk music, folk dances, traditional musical instruments, and other cultural performances showcasing the land, people, and unique cultural charm of each region.
